Sec.  3282.304  Inadequate State plan.



    If the Secretary determines that a State plan submitted under this 

subpart is not adequate, the designated State agency shall be informed 

of the additions and corrections required for approval. A revised State 

plan shall be submitted within 30 days of receipt of such determination. 

If the revised State plan is inadequate or if the State fails to 

resubmit within the 30 day period or otherwise indicates that it does 

not intend to change its State plan as submitted, the Secretary shall 

notify the designated State agency that the State plan is not approved 

and that it has a right to a hearing on the disapproval in accordance 

with subpart D of this part.
